As a member of the Materials team the Shipper/Material Handler reports to the Materials Manager. The Shipper/Material Handler is responsible receiving goods and shipping completed products. Work must be done in a safe and efficient manner and comply with all Stackpole International’s Health & Safety policies, procedures and quality systems. Your responsibilities will be to:

- Work from shipping report, ship list, and advisement from ship co-coordinator to prepare shipments.
- Perform secondary operations (e.g. tumbling, oil impregnating, steam treating and packing)
- Safety transport properly identified material from process to process and store in appropriate location
- Communicate with operators and observe parts requirements in order to maintain a continuous supply of material for secondary operations.
- Ship, receive, move and store materials consigned to and from Stackpole International, Stratford from suppliers, outside processors, services, customers and internal departments.
- Collect and dispose of scrap bins, floor sweepings, scrap powder and parts at Compacting.
- Prepare load sheets, and load trucks for outgoing shipments.
- Prepare shipping documents as required. Sign out loads, distribute paper work and generate / send ASN’s.
- Follow-up transmission of ASN within 1 hour of shipment. (Note: Done by day shift shipper in the absence of ship coordinator and by afternoon shipper after ship coordinator leaves at 4:00 p.m.)
- Receive and inspect goods received for gross content, and damages. Stamp packing slips as required and forward to shipping coordinator. Issue receiving discrepancy report as required and attach to packing slip.
- Weigh, label, package outgoing product as described by process sheets and packaging information.
- Complete parts traceability tags for products packed and returned to quality department.
- Maintain clean and orderly work area including yard and cartoon storage area.
- Prepare maintenance lift truck checks daily.
- Fill in for material handler in the processing of parts in secondary area during absenteeism or as assigned by supervisor on second shift to process parts required for current shift or start of next shift production.
- Ensures that the requirements of the Quality Management System and Environmental Health and Safety Systems are met.
- Other duties as required.

Qualifications:

- Must have legible writing in order to complete product description tags and assist in inventory counts.
- Must be physically fit in order to move/lift items weighing up to 50 lbs.
- Awareness of safe lifting techniques and proper forklift operation.
- Previous forklift experience an asset.

Technical & Skill Requirements:

- Lift truck license

Work Environment (including Physical Demands):

- Walking, driving a tow motor for extended periods of time
- Requires concentration
- Busy, fast paced job
